All requests proxied from node A to node B will forward the X-Sender
header in the request to B.
Transaction will be sent to recipient
and their response returned in payload
.
Example request:
POST /transaction
{
"sender": "8081",
"recipient": "8080",
"amount": "1"
}
Response example:
{
"payload": {
"Code": 1
},
"title": "OK"
}
Block in data
will be sent to all recipients
and responses returned in payload
.

Example request:
POST /transaction
{
"sender": "8081",
"recipient": "8080",
"amount": "1"
}
Response example:
{
Code: 1
}
Response codes:
Code | Description |
---|---|
1 | The transaction was received successfully |
2 | The request body could not be parsed |
3 | The transaction could not be parsed from the body |
Example request:
POST /block
{
"index": "5",
"timestamp": "1510332444551936900",
"transactions": [{
"sender": "8081", "recipient": "8080", "amount": "1"
},{
"sender": "8081", "recipient": "8080", "amount": "1"
}],
"proof": "T5AEAA==",
"prevHash": "tDw6oL/3BxXN+pTY6o/8M6eVBcKsUow3YTQgl88BscY="
}
Response example:
{
Code: 1
}
Response codes:
Code | Description |
---|---|
1 | The block was received successfully |
2 | The request body could not be parsed |
3 | The block could not be parsed from the body |
Fetch a chain of blocks from this node. If a lastBlockHash
is provided, return Code: 1
with all the blocks on the chain after and not including the specified block.
If lastBlockHash
is not found in the chain, the chain may have forked. Return Code: 2
with the entire chain.
Example request:
GET /chain?lastBlockHash=tDw6oL%2F3BxXN%2BpTY6o%2F8M6eVBcKsUow3YTQgl88BscY%3D
Response example:
{
Code: 1,
Payload: [{
"index": "2",
"timestamp": "1510332444551936900",
"transactions": [{
"sender": "8081", "recipient": "8080", "amount": "1"
},{
"sender": "8081", "recipient": "8080", "amount": "1"
}],
"proof": "T5AEAA==",
"prevHash": "tDw6oL/3BxXN+pTY6o/8M6eVBcKsUow3YTQgl88BscY="
}, ...]
}
Response codes:
Code | Description |
---|---|
1 | The tail of the chain was returned |
2 | The hash was not found, and the entire chain was returned |
